## Session Handling: Quistrel Upstream Circuit Breaker

Heads up, new folks: when the Quistrel API starts timing out, our breaker trips after 5 failures and holds sessions in a local cache for 90 seconds. Don't retry manually — the breaker handles it. Half-open probes run every 30s. To test probe behavior in staging, authenticate with the token below.

login token, bagug-kafop: eyJhbGciOiJIUzI1NiIsInR5cCI6IkpXVCJ9.eyJzdWIiOiIcMLov2In0.Z5RLDIfp

HANDOVER NOTE — From the Director of Regional Operations to the incoming Director

For branch managers' awareness: the Copper Hollow office will close at the end of next quarter. Staff there (six people) have been offered transfers to the Marwick Street site; two have accepted so far. Lease exit penalties are modest and already budgeted. Furniture disposal and records archiving are with facilities. Please manage local messaging consistently, as the closure connects directly to the plans noted below.

management briefing: Project Ulavan slips by two quarters because of the staffing delay.

Handover for the Ostermill billing tables work. I completed monthly partitioning on the events table; partitions are created two months ahead by the nightly maintenance job. The backfill for January through June is verified against row counts. One caution for the release: the partition-creation job must run before the cutover, or inserts will fail. The job currently runs with the following configuration values.

deployment values, yadug-bawif:
[framir]
team = pelox
access_code = ac_a38ab2
owner = tamion.julael
host = framir.tolvaqlabs.test
port = 11211
peer = tammir.zemvargrid.local
salt = 2215ef03
pin = 1541

## Load Testing the Checkout Flow (Cartwheel staging)

Quick note for security review: our load rig hammers the Cartwheel checkout at ~400 rps using synthetic carts only — no real payment data ever touches staging. The harness runs from the Bramblefield cluster and needs auth against the mock payment gateway, otherwise every request 401s and the numbers are garbage. Throttle limits are enforced gateway-side, so don't worry about runaway traffic. Before kicking off a run, add this line to your env file:

env line for yahip-tafog: RELAY_SECRET3=4ca